Transaction 07e6fce21dc76a5f5e081b7529d092f873169b9672f161074501f7537aa8e59e

1 Input
2 Outputs
  • 07e6fce21dc76a5f5e081b7529d092f873169b9672f161074501f7537aa8e59e:0
  • value  88676204
    address  31oniA938YUnzJv73GPfJwpgNXccx9jbFd
  • 07e6fce21dc76a5f5e081b7529d092f873169b9672f161074501f7537aa8e59e:1
  • value  1649600
    address  3F9NXpAreUgKkBDSi8AH7L63uaziiShNWy